Is there some way of working out what the effective focal ranges would be on a certain type of lens with various tubes attached? Is it relatively simple maths or is there some sort of conversion chart you can use? I recall someone mentioning that the Kerso tubes came with some sort of Image Magnification table on the instruction leaflet, but I don't own a set and therefore don't have access to that information.

I'm looking to hopefully pair a set with a Canon TS-E 90mm f/2.8 lens but I'm not sure what the overall effect(s) would be.
 
On the TS-E90, you'll get the following;

12mm tube will give you a magnification range of 0.43-0.14x at a working distance of 264-691mm
25mm tube will give you a magnification range of 0.60-0.31x at a working distance of 207-345mm

Going much beyond this gives such a narrow range of working distance that framing becomes difficult and it isn't really practical.
